基于GPS的公交车智能报站系统设计

         

摘要

As an important transportation, the bus is becoming a beautiful landscape in urban transportation now. With the improvement of city modernization, people have put forward higher requirements on the technology of the city bus station. Therefore, the optimization design on bus intelligent stop-reporting system is necessary conducted. The system is based on GPS technology and the single-chip technology is used in this paper. The system of intelligent bus reporting is scientifically demonstrated and the intelligent station announcer with good function is designed. Besides, the hardware systems and modules are designed, which are consisted of control module, GPS module, button module, voice broadcast module and liquid crystal display module. KEIL C51 is adopted to design software system, the main function module is analyzed and described. Finally, the EDA software tool PROTEUS 7.10 is used to the system simulation, which basically realized intelligent bus reporting function. The system designed in this paper can achieve automatic station reporting function and change the manual control station mode, so it has good use values and application prospects.%公交车作为重要的交通工具,已成为城市交通中一道亮丽的风景.随着城市现代化水平的提高,人们对城市公交车报站技术提出了更高的要求,为此需对公交车报站系统进行优化设计.本文以 GPS 定位技术为基础,采用单片机技术,对公交车智能报站系统进行了科学论证,设计了功能较全的智能报站器.对硬件系统和主要功能模块进行了规划和设计,其中系统硬件设计模块主要包含主控模块、GPS模块、按键模块、语音播放模块和液晶显示模块.同时采用KEIL对系统进行软件设计,对主要功能模块进行了分析和描述.最后,采用EDA工具软件PROTEUS 7.10进行系统仿真实验,基本上实现了智能报站功能.利用文中设计的系统,可实现自动报站功能,改变了手工操控报站方式,因此具有一定的使用价值和应用前景.
